Product details

The AOM-TPM-9665V-C hardware security chip from Super Micro Computer is an advanced security module specifically designed for servers and client PCs with Intel Core i5, i7, and Xeon E3 processors. This module meets the requirements of the Trusted Computing Group (TCG) 2.0 standards and provides a robust solution for securing data and supporting security applications. The chip enables the implementation of features such as secure boot processes, encryption, and authentication, ensuring the integrity of the system. With its compact design, the AOM-TPM-9665V-C is easy to integrate and is ideal for use in various server environments. Utilizing this module enhances the security architecture and protects against unauthorized access to sensitive information.

  • Meets TCG 2.0 standards for enhanced data security
  • Compatible with Intel Core i5, i7, and Xeon E3 processors
  • Supports secure boot processes and encryption applications.
